BEFORE THE BOARD OF SOCIAL WORK EXAMINERS

AND PROFESSIONAL COUNSELORS

DEPARTMENT OF LABOR AND INDUSTRY

STATE OF MONTANA

 

In the matter of the amendment of ARM 24.219.401, 24.219.405, and 24.219.409 fee schedule

)

)

)

NOTICE OF PUBLIC HEARING ON PROPOSED AMENDMENT

 

 

TO:  All Concerned Persons

 

            1.  On October 15, 2012, at 9:00 a.m., a public hearing will be held in room B-07, 301 South Park Avenue, Helena, Montana, to consider the proposed amendment of the above-stated rules.

            3.  GENERAL STATEMENT OF REASONABLE NECESSITY:  The board determined it is reasonably necessary to amend the fees as proposed to comply with the provisions of 37-1-134, MCA, and keep the board's fees commensurate with program costs.  The department, in providing administrative services to the board, has determined that fees must be increased as proposed to cover appropriated expenditures.  The board estimates that approximately 231 applications and 2,232 renewals will be affected by the proposed fee changes and will result in additional annual revenue of $210,110.96.  The board has not raised fees for license applications and renewals since 2003.

            The board is eliminating the original license fee as a separate fee, and instead incorporating it into the $200 application fee.  Years ago, the board collected this fee at the end of the licensure process, as an accommodation to applicants.  The board has concluded that it should be collected at the beginning of the licensure process, as that is where the bulk of the application work is done by staff.

            The board determined it is reasonably necessary to set and collect the continuing education (CE) application fee to cover the additional staff time necessary to build CE logs, approve applications weekly, and update the web site CE list on a weekly basis.  The board has not been collecting a fee for these services, and it is necessary to do so to comply with 37-1-134, MCA, and keep fees commensurate with associated costs.

 

            4.  The rules proposed to be amended provide as follows, stricken matter interlined, new matter underlined: 

 

            24.219.401  FEE SCHEDULE FOR SOCIAL WORKERS

            (1)  Application fee                                                                                  $50 200

            (2)  Original license fee                                                                                    50

            (3) (2)  Renewal fee (based on annual renewal)                               100 175

            (4) (3)  Renewal fee (inactive to active)                                               100 175

            (5) (4)  Inactive license fee (based on annual renewal)                        50 88

            (5)  Continuing education application                                                           20

            (6) remains the same.

 

            AUTH:  37-1-134, 37-22-201, MCA

            IMP:     37-1-134, 37-1-141, 37-22-302, MCA

 

            24.219.405  FEE SCHEDULE FOR PROFESSIONAL COUNSELORS

            (1)  Application fee                                                                                  $50 200

            (2)  Original license fee                                                                                    50

            (3) (2)  Renewal fee (based on annual renewal)                               100 175

            (4) (3)  Renewal fee (inactive to active)                                               100 175

            (5) (4)  Inactive license fee (based on annual renewal)                        50 88

            (5)  Continuing education application                                                           20

            (6) remains the same.

 

            AUTH:  37-1-134, 37-22-201, MCA

            IMP:     37-1-134, 37-1-141, 37-23-206, MCA

 

            24.219.409  FEE SCHEDULE FOR MARRIAGE AND FAMILY THERAPISTS

            (1)  Application/original license fee                                                    $100 200

            (2)  Renewal fee (based on annual renewal)                                     100 175

            (3)  Renewal fee (inactive to active)                                                     100 175

            (4)  Temporary permit Inactive license fee

            (based on annual renewal)                                                                        50 88

            (5)  Continuing education application                                                           20

            (5) remains the same, but is renumbered (6).

 

            AUTH:  37-1-134, 37-37-201, MCA

            IMP:     37-1-134, 37-1-141, 37-37-201, MCA
